Irwin, Kathryn C. – Education and Treatment of Children, 1991
Eight students with Down's syndrome, aged 11 through 13, were taught to add by counting-on in a 5-day teaching program. Teaching included instruction in component skills and use of precision teaching techniques. All students continued to use the technique six months later and generalized the technique to other materials. (Author/DB)

Kulm, Gerald – 1985
Recent research has provided a reasonably coherent picture of how children learn to add and subtract. There is clear evidence that children do not learn simply by mastering a procedure and storing in memory. Instead, learning is structured in meaningful ways, connected to previous knowledge, and adapted to new contexts. This view of learning has…
